5) Andrea Apple opened Apple Photography on January 1 of the current year. During January, the following transactions occurred and were recorded in the company's books: [Your focus is on the cash increases and decreases 1. Andrea invested $13.500 cash in the business in exchange for common stock. 2. Andrea contributed $20,000 of photography equipment to the business 3. The company paid $2,100 cash for an insurance policy covering the next 24 months. 4. The company received $5,700 cash for services provided during January 5. The company purchased $6,200 of office equipment on credit. 6. The company provided $2,750 of services to customers on account. 7. The company paid cash of $1,500 for monthly rent. 8. The company paid $3,100 on the office equipment purchased in transaction #5 above. 9. Paid $275 cash for January utilities. Cash Based on this information, the balance in the cash account at the end of January would be: A) $41,450. B) $12,225. C) $18,700. D) $15,250. E) $13,500
